Tetrachloroethene is a chlorocarbon that is tetrachloro substituted ethene. It has a role as a nephrotoxic agent. It is a member of chloroethenes and a chlorocarbon.
Source: ChEBI
| Molecular formula | C2Cl4 |
|---|---|
| Molecular weight | 165.8 g/mol |
| IUPAC name | 1,1,2,2-tetrachloroethene |
| InChIKey | CYTYCFOTNPOANT-UHFFFAOYSA-N |
| SMILES | C(=C(Cl)Cl)(Cl)Cl |
